So, I've been looking for a reverse rack lately, and when scanning the Kijiji pages here in Calgary, I found this. A Jenn-Air DU855W. Included in the sale was the original owners manual. This is a Jenn-Air clone of the WU1000. It is belt driven. As you can see, the control panel has yellowed thanks to the fire retardant chemicals in plastic.

The racks are in good condition, although they required some re-rack. I would like to find better racks. Minimal restoration was required, as the pump and interior was in very good condition.

Does anyone have a control panel to a WU1000 in any colour they would be willing to sell?

These machines are fantastic, and very forgiving when it comes to loading, and not to mention the capacity they have is insane. Everything comes out clean. I was expecting it to be loud though, but its a lot quieter than the GE machines I own.

Racks

You can find the racks for these beauties on ebay. They range anywhere from 80 to 100 plus depending on which ones you want. I suggest that you replace your bottom rack with the tier shelf on the inside instead of the outside for the simple reason you have more room for tall glasses all the way to the front with the opposite configuration. Also you loose a few inches of wasted space the way it is set in yours. These are by far some of the best dishwashers that made other than the real Kitchenaides made by Hobart... but for me I still love my Maytag. I have the model down from yours that is all pushbuttons with no dial. I actually have a second one I got for free that I found on Craiglist for a parts machine.
